AMM090: Configuring the Quantum module AMM 090 00
Original instructions
Function description
The function block is used to edit the configuration data of an AMM 090 00 Quantum module for subsequent use by the scaling EFBs.
This module has 4 bipolar input channels for mixed voltage and current processing. The module also has 2 current output channels.
For the configuration of an AMM 090 00 the function block in the configuration section is connected to the corresponding SLOT output of the QUANTUM or DROP function block. The %IW references and %MW references references specified in the I/O map are automatically assigned internally to the individual channels and can therefore only be occupied by Unlocated variables.
The analog values can be further processed in Scalings Sections using the function blocks I_NORM, I_NORM_WARN, I_PHYS, I_PHYS_WARN, I_RAW, I_SCALE, I_SCALE_WARN for inputs and O_NORM, O_SCALE, and O_RAW for the outputs.
EN and ENO can be configured as additional parameters.

Representation in IL
Representation:
CAL AMM090_Instance (SLOT:=SlotModulePosition,
    IN1=>InputChannel1, IN2=>InputChannel2,
    IN3=>InputChannel3, IN4=>InputChannel4,
    OUT1=>OutputChannel1, OUT2=>OutputChannel2)
Representation in ST
Representation:
AMM090_Instance (SLOT:=SlotModulePosition,
    IN1=>InputChannel1, IN2=>InputChannel2,
    IN3=>InputChannel3, IN4=>InputChannel4,
    OUT1=>OutputChannel1, OUT2=>OutputChannel2) ;

Runtime error
If no AMM 090 00 module has been configured for the specified SLOT input, an error message is returned.
The range warning for the input channels can be evaluated using the I_NORM_WARN, I_PHYS_WARN or I_SCALE_WARN function blocks.
The status message "Open circuit or range violation on channel" can be requested via the status register defined in the I/O map.
